Cane Bay was not able to break out of their rough patch on Monday as the team picked up their sixth straight defeat. They were a single run away from ending the streak, but they lost an 8-7 heartbreaker at the hands of the Summerville Green Wave. If the Cobras were looking for revenge after losing 12-2 to the Green Wave when the teams met back in March of 2021, then they'll just have to keep looking.
Ethan Dodson was cooking despite his team's loss, going a perfect 2-for-2 with one stolen base, one run, and one RBI. Another player making a difference was Niko Alvarez, who went 1-for-3 with two RBI and one double.
Cane Bay's loss dropped their record down to 10-14. As for Summerville, the victory made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 19-8.
While Cane Bay had to take the loss, they won't have to wait long to give it another shot: the pair's next game is a rematch scheduled at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
